Rodrigo Patricio Ruiz de Barbieri (born 10 May 1972) is a former Chilean professional footballer and current manager of Los Cabos United.

He played for Unión Española, Regional Atacama, Toros Neza, Santos Laguna, Pachuca, Veracruz, and last played for Estudiantes Tecos of the Ascenso MX.

During the qualifiers to the 1998 FIFA World Cup, Ruiz played a match with the Chile national team against Uruguay at Centenario Stadium, that Chile lost 1–0.

In total, he made 7 appearances for Chile and scored one goal.

After working in Lobos Zacatepec and Irritilas FC, he joined Los Cabos United in 2022.

He was nicknamed Pony by his former fellow footballer in Unión Española, Mario Lucca, due to his strength and height.

He naturalized Mexican by residence.
